Transaction c290cd6100ea20679d3e533618ec4f9620dd1e493fce39ded916cfbb044f5c5a

2 Input
2 Outputs
  • c290cd6100ea20679d3e533618ec4f9620dd1e493fce39ded916cfbb044f5c5a:0
  • value  8948
    address  12D5mgCKhHTLNaZPkgzrhVEbyfzNs7f2fa
  • c290cd6100ea20679d3e533618ec4f9620dd1e493fce39ded916cfbb044f5c5a:1
  • value  1252802
    address  3MPt5T5frUTVmichrnhbnyWNBzXFB9PSVP